About this ranking

Schools are ranked by the percentage of students who scored at or above the CT Smarter Balanced % Met or Exceeded Standard threshold on the latest available CT Smarter Balanced Mathematics test (school year 2024-25). A higher percentage is better.

Only public schools with a reasonable cohort size are included (at least 50 total students enrolled, since the source file does not include per-subject student counts), so very small programs and special-purpose centers are filtered out.

The state average shown above is enrollment-weighted: we multiply each school's score by how many of its students tested, sum those across every public school in Connecticut, and divide by the total students tested. This way a big school counts more than a tiny one in the typical-student average.
